#e216e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e216e0 is composed of 88.6% red, 8.6%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 0.9%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 300.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 48.6%. #e216e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cff with #c500c1.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#e216e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e216e0 has RGB values of R:226, G:22,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.01,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14816992.

Shades and Tints of #e216e0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010b is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e216e0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837582 is the less saturated color, while #f503f3 is the most saturated one.
